Model Suit Gunpla Builders Beginning G

Model Suit Gunpla Builders Beginning G is an original video animation series produced by Sunrise to celebrate the 30th anniversary of the Gundam plastic model kits. It's directed by Kou Matsuo and written by Yousuke Kuroda, and features character designs by Kaichiro Terada. The OVA was released in August 15, 2010 to December 19, 2010 with 3 15-minute Episodes. Unlike other Gundam titles, Gunpla Builders Beginning G takes place in a present-day timeline. Aside to the OAV, two manga sequels were released in Dengeki Hobby Magazine.

Kansatsui Asagao

Asagao (Juri Ueno) is a rookie forensic scientist, who works at a university forensic medicine class in Kanagawa Prefecture. She is a licensed doctor and respected by those around her. Asagao lives with her father Taira (Saburo Tokito), who is a veteran detective. Asago's mother died in the 2011 Tohoku earthquake disaster and her mother’s body was never found. One day, Asagao’s forensic medicine class unexpectedly works with the investigation section of the police department. When a dead body is found, the dead body is transferred to Asagao’s forensic medicine class. Asagao now works with her detective father.

Budoy

Budoy is a Philippine drama television series that premiered on ABS-CBN. It tackles the story of Budoy, who is mentally challenged, and his family, relationships and social issues. It topbills Gerald Anderson, Jessy Mendiola and Enrique Gil. The theme song was "Saan Darating Ang Umaga" sung by Angeline Quinto produced by Jonathan Manalo. The show ended on March 9, 2012 with the new primetime drama series "Dahil Sa Pag-ibig" taking its place the following week. The show is notable for the main character's catchphrases such as "Hello, ako Budoy!" and "Jackie, gusto mo BJ?", with the latter phrase being mistaken as a double-meaning line.

We Love You, Mr. Jin

When your parents don’t approve of your spouse, is a happy life possible? Mi Xiao Mi is a reporter for a Beijing news agency who meets and falls in love with Jin Liang, a gynecologist. When Xiao Mi insists on marrying Liang, a “bei piao” (a non-native Beijing resident), Xiao Mi’s single mother, Wang Shu Hua, nearly has a heart attack but is forced to accept the relationship. But when living with Liang’s father, Jin Tai Zhu, turns out to be more difficult than imagined, Xiao Mi’s mother refuses to just stand by and just watch. “We Love You, Mr. Jin,” also known as “Jin Tai Lang’s Happy Life,” is a 2012 Chinese drama series directed by Yu Chun.
